Activating mods on vehicles requires you to hold down R2 to bring up the radial menu then select the item you want, then release R2. It's pretty touchy, and it's easy to end up not selecting anything. |

That helps a bit, but doesn't go far enough.
Some functions simply require a hard button, and the solution is the ability to assign modules to whatever buttons we want.
They could allow us to tag slots with an ID for each fitting, then allow us to assign those IDs to controls by vehicle type.
I personally don't need to check the leader board, nor can i call in any assets when I am flying. I don't use PPT either, so that gives me three D-Pad buttons or active modules right there. If I ever make a fitting with four active modules I can give up the map. |
